An Interview with Local Artist George Van Hook

George Van Hook
Print Friendly

By Cora Sugarman
George Van Hook is an American Impressionist painter from Cambridge, NY. He is internationally recognized for his colorful and evocative oil paintings, which he creates ‘en plein air.’ Inspired by his natural surroundings, Van Hook is a master of light and atmosphere and works directly from his own visual life. Capturing the Great Outdoors: An Interview with Photographer Carl Heilman II

Carl Heilman II
Print Friendly

By Nancy O’Brien
Carl Heilman II is well known for capturing the beauty of the Adirondacks in his photographs, along with images of National Parks and other areas of natural beauty.
